A global report says well be drowning in a tidal wave of electronic waste in a few years. The world produced nearly 54 milliontons of ewaste last year. Thats the weight of eight bricks for each of the earths seven million people. A forecast by unites nations organizations predicts by 2017 the amount of ewaste willow by a thrird to 72 million tons. Ewaste consists of used computers, cell phones, tvs, and even refrigerators. The good news is the recycling of ewaste is also on the rise. The navy plans to enkreis testing the effects of snow far on whales and dolphins. It affects the way they dive, communicate and feed. Some whales try to escape the sonar. Scientist believe it could be causing mass strandings and deaths. The navy is working with whale researchers in Southern California to figure out the effects of snow far on large groups whales.
